How To Fix /SAPAPO/SRC238 - Scheduling agreement item &1 &2 not being processed


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SAPAPO/SRC -

  • Message number: 238

  • Message text: Scheduling agreement item &1 &2 not being processed

    The SAP error message /SAPAPO/SRC238 Scheduling agreement item &1 &2 not being processed typically occurs in the context of Advanced Planning and Optimization (APO) when there are issues related to scheduling agreements in the system. Here’s a breakdown of the potential causes, solutions, and related information for this error:

    Causes:

    1. Missing or Incomplete Data: The scheduling agreement item may be missing critical data required for processing, such as delivery dates, quantities, or other relevant fields.
    2. Status Issues: The scheduling agreement item might be in a status that prevents it from being processed (e.g., blocked, deleted, or not released).
    3. Configuration Issues: There may be configuration settings in the APO system that are not aligned with the requirements for processing scheduling agreements.
    4. Master Data Issues: Problems with master data (e.g., material master, vendor master) can lead to this error if the data is incomplete or incorrect.
    5. Integration Issues: If there are issues with the integration between SAP ERP and SAP APO, it can lead to scheduling agreement items not being processed correctly.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Data Completeness: Review the scheduling agreement item for any missing or incomplete data. Ensure that all required fields are filled out correctly.
    2. Review Status: Check the status of the scheduling agreement item. If it is blocked or in a status that prevents processing, take the necessary steps to change its status.
    3. Configuration Review: Consult with your SAP configuration team to ensure that the settings for scheduling agreements in APO are correctly configured.
    4. Master Data Validation: Validate the master data related to the scheduling agreement item. Ensure that the material and vendor data are complete and accurate.
    5. Integration Check: If applicable, check the integration settings between SAP ERP and SAP APO. Ensure that data is being transferred correctly and that there are no errors in the integration process.
    6. Error Logs: Review any error logs or messages in the system for additional context on why the scheduling agreement item is not being processed.
